Cara Mengubah Web Server Ke Nginx
Mengapa Harus Mengubah Web Server?
Salah satu alasan penting mengubah web server adalah kecepatan. Nginx, sebuah web server open source, bertindak sebagai reverse proxy, layanan streaming, dan paket HTTP lainnya. Ketika Anda menggunakan Nginx, Anda dapat menikmati kecepatan yang istimewa. Dari perspektif keamanan, Nginx memberikan tingkat yang lebih tinggi. Jika Anda ingin membangun platform yang aman dan terpercaya, Nginx adalah pilihan yang baik untuk mengubah web server Anda.
Langkah-Langkah Menggunakan Nginx
Sederhana dan mudah, kami membagi langkah-langkah menggunakan Nginx menjadi tiga bagian. Harap diperhatikan bahwa formulir yang kami gunakan adalah Centos 8. pertama, pastikan bahwa Anda sudah memiliki akses root. Apabila tidak memiliki akses root, harap berbicara dengan administrator sistem Anda. Faktor keamanan lainnya adalah firewall. Jika Anda menggunakan centos 8.0 ke atas, pastikan firewall aktif. Sekarang, mari kita mulai dengan langkah pertama.
Langkah 1: Pemasangan Nginx
Pada bagian ini, kita akan menginstal Nginx di server kita. Untuk memulai, jalankan perintah ini: yum install Nginx. Kemudian, konfirmasikan instalasi dan jalankan perintah berikut: systemctl start Nginx untuk memulai daemon Nginx. Selain itu, Anda juga harus menjalankan perintah berikut: systemctl enable Nginx untuk memastikan bahwa Nginx tetap berjalan ketika Anda menyalakan ulang server. Langkah ini penting. Jika Anda melewatkannya, Nginx tidak akan aktif ketika Anda menyalakan ulang server.
Langkah 2: Konfigurasi Nginx
Selanjutnya, Anda harus menyusun konfigurasi Nginx. File konfigurasi Nginx berada di direktori /etc/nginx. Pada tahap ini, penting untuk membaca konfigurasi dan memahaminya. File ini berisi semua informasi yang diperlukan untuk mengonfigurasi Nginx. Selain itu, pastikan bahwa Anda mengubah bagian yang relevan untuk pengaturan Anda. Diatur secara predefinisi, Nginx diatur menggunakan standar. Jika Anda tidak yakin tentang konfigurasi Nginx, Anda dapat meminta bantuan kepada administrator sistem atau kepada pengembang yang berpengalaman.
Langkah 3: Konten Web
Selanjutnya, Anda harus menyiapkan konten web. File web berada di direktori /var/www/html. Uni ke direktori ini dan siapkan semua file yang Anda butuhkan. Saat menyiapkan file, merujuk kepada dokumentasi untuk mengetahui syarat konten web. file berformat html, css, dan JavaScript adalah standar. Namun, dokumentasi menguraikan syarat yang lebih spesifik. Lakukan tes situs web untuk memastikan bahwa semuanya berjalan dengan lancar. Jika Anda melihat masalah, baca dokumentasi Nginx lebih lanjut.
Langkah 4: Mangontrol Akses
Kemudian, Anda harus mengatur kontrol akses. Perintah berikut menyimpulkan proses ini:
useradd {username} -M -s /sbin/nologin
usermod -a -G nginx {username}
Perintah tersebut memastikan bahwa tidak ada pengguna yang dapat mengakses file web Anda. Jika Anda menginginkan kemampuan untuk mengelola file web, Anda harus menambahkan pengguna apache menggunakan perintah berikut:
useradd apache -M -s /usr/bin/bash
usermod -a -G apache {username}
Langkah 5: Pengujian Nginx
Terakhir, buat jam tes untuk memastikan bahwa semua konfigurasi berfungsi dengan lancar. Gunakan perintah berikut:
sudo systemctl start Nginx
sudo systemctl restart Nginx
Nginx akan mulai dan kemudian berjalan. Tes situs web sebelum Anda mengakhirinya. Ini penting untuk memastikan bahwa Nginx berfungsi dengan lancar.
FAQ
- Apakah Proses Mengubah Web Server Berbahaya?
Tidak. Proses yang kami jelaskan aman dan akan berfungsi dengan lancar. Namun, pastikan bahwa Anda menyiapkan konten web Anda secara benar. - Apakah Perubahan Ini Berlaku Untuk Semua Linux?
Ternyata tidak. Kami temukan bahwa Nginx hanya tersedia untuk Centos 8. Hal ini berlaku juga untuk distro linux lainnya. Pastikan bahwa versi yang digunakan mendukung Nginx. - Apakah Anggota Yang Ditambahkan Berfungsi?
Anggota khusus ini berfungsi sebagai firewall tambahan. Ini berlaku untuk pengguna yang ditambahkan melalui perintah yang kami jelaskan.
Kesimpulan
Menggunakan Nginx adalah bentuk kecerdasan yang mungkin harus Anda lakukan. Nginx adalah web server open source yang dapat Anda gunakan untuk meningkatkan performa. Mulailah dengan langkah-langkah kami dan pastikan untuk menguasai konsep sebelum memulainya. Terima kasih telah membaca artikel ini dan jangan lupa untuk membaca artikel lainnya.
Related Posts:
- Aplikasi Spotify Sebagai Sarana Belajar Bahasa… Mempelajari bahasa asing bisa menjadi tugas yang mengintimidasi. Dibutuhkan dedikasi, hafalan, dan latihan. Tetapi dengan alat yang tepat, belajar bahasa asing bisa menjadi pengalaman yang menyenangkan dan bermanfaat. Aplikasi Spotify…
- Cara Install Dan Nginx Di Ubuntu Cara Install Dan Nginx di Ubuntu Apa itu Nginx? Nginx adalah web server yang sangat ringan namun bertenaga. Ini dirancang untuk bisa menangan volume tinggi request, dan timbal balik yang…
- Bagaimana Cara Membuat Akun Paypal Jika Anda Baru… Jika Anda baru mengenal PayPal, membuat akun itu cepat dan mudah. Dengan akun PayPal Anda, Anda dapat dengan aman melakukan pembayaran dan mentransfer dana secara online. Anda juga dapat menggunakan…
- Aplikasi Netflix Dan Kualitas Streaming Video Karena streaming terus menjadi cara yang disukai untuk menonton film dan acara, Netflix memimpin paket dengan beragam aplikasi dan streaming video berkualitas. Dengan lebih dari 200 juta pelanggan di 190…
- Cara Merubah Web Server Apache Ke Nginx Pada Debian 9 Cara Merubah Web Server Apache Ke Nginx Pada Debian 9 Apa itu Web Server Apache dan Nginx? Web Server Apache dan Nginx adalah web server open-source yang dikembangkan guna membuat…
- Docker Nginx Change Location Django Docker Nginx Change Location Django Docker dan Nginx adalah dua teknologi yang berbeda yang saling melengkapi untuk membangun sebuah aplikasi web. Docker dapat membantu dalam pengelolaan container, sedangkan Nginx digunakan…
- Menghapus Log Nginx Vps Centos Menghapus Log Nginx Vps Centos Apa itu Nginx? Nginx adalah web server HTTP, proxy, dan mail server yang sangat populer untuk mesin Linux, Windows, dan macOS. Ini banyak digunakan untuk…
- Cara Install Php 7 Di Nginx Cara Install Php 7 Di Nginx Tantangan yang Dihadapi Ketika Install PHP 7 di Nginx Memasang PHP 7 di Nginx adalah tantangan yang beragam. Sebagai contoh, penting untuk mengidentifikasi berbagai…
- Langkah-Langkah Install Php Nginx Linux Langkah-Langkah Install Php Nginx Linux Apa itu PHP Nginx Linux? PHP Nginx Linux adalah sebuah platform web open-source yang berjalan di atas sistem operasi Linux. Platform ini dapat memberikan kinerja…
- Ubuntu 18.04 Wordpress Nginx Ubuntu 18.04 Wordpress Nginx Apa Itu Ubuntu 18.04 ? Ubuntu 18.04 adalah versi terbaru dari Ubuntu, sebuah sistem operasi sumber terbuka yang dapat Anda gunakan di komputer Anda. Ubuntu 18.04…
- Perkembangan Aplikasi Spotify Dalam Beberapa Tahun… Layanan streaming musik Spotify telah menjadi pemain utama dalam industri musik digital selama beberapa tahun terakhir. Aplikasi ini telah ada sejak lama, tetapi telah melalui beberapa perkembangan besar yang telah…
- Cek Directory Nginx Di Centos Cek Directory Nginx Di Centos Apa Itu Nginx? Nginx adalah salah satu web server open source yang saat ini populer di web. Nginx secara khusus berfungsi sebagai webserver, reverse proxy,…
- Cara Melakukan Pembayaran Dengan Paypal Melakukan pembayaran dengan PayPal adalah salah satu cara paling populer untuk membayar secara online. Ini cepat, aman, dan mudah digunakan. PayPal adalah prosesor pembayaran yang memungkinkan bisnis dan individu untuk…
- Mengoptimalkan Kinerja Lenovo Ideapad K1 Dengan… Lenovo Ideapad K1 adalah salah satu laptop terkemuka yang menawarkan berbagai fitur canggih. Jika Anda baru saja membeli Lenovo Ideapad K1, Anda pasti menikmati kinerjanya yang cepat. Namun, dengan waktu…
- Nginx Tidak Bisa Di Restart Nginx Tidak Bisa Di Restart Jika Anda pengguna Nginx, Anda pasti menghadapi masalah yang sering terjadi: nginx tidak bisa di restart. Ini adalah masalah yang umum dan normal dan dapat…
- Mengatasi 404 Not Found Di Nginx Ubuntu Mengatasi 404 Not Found Di Nginx Ubuntu Apa Yang Dimaksud Dengan 404 Not Found? 404 Not Found adalah pesan yang muncul ketika Anda mencoba mengakses halaman web yang berbasis Nginx…
- Cara Ubah Port Nginx Debian 7 Cara Ubah Port Nginx Debian 7 Apakah Nginx? Nginx adalah server web yang open source dan software yang memungkinkan Anda untuk mengatur server web dengan mudah. Seperti Apache, Nginx dapat…
- Menjalankan Ruby Di Vps Nginx Ubuntu Menjalankan Ruby di VPS Nginx Ubuntu Apa itu Ruby? Ruby adalah bahasa pemrograman open source yang hebat. Ini adalah salah satu bahasa pemrograman objek terkemuka yang dapat digunakan untuk mengembangkan…
- Cara Menggunakan Aplikasi Netflix Di Chromecast Ketika layanan streaming menjadi semakin populer, banyak orang mencari cara untuk menonton acara dan film favorit mereka. Jika Anda memiliki perangkat Chromecast, Anda mungkin bertanya - tanya bagaimana cara menggunakan…
- Cara Menggunakan Kartu Yang Sesuai Dengan Kondisi… Memainkan game populer Clash Royale adalah cara yang pasti untuk memompa adrenalin Anda. Dengan pertempuran yang serba cepat dan persaingan yang ketat, tidak heran mengapa begitu populer. Tetapi jika Anda…
- Nginx Config With More Secure Nginx Config With More Secure Nginx adalah salah satu web server yang populer digunakan untuk mengatur lalu lintas HTTP serta membagi beban pada banyak server. Nginx juga mendukung banyak jenis…
- Tips Dan Trik Menghadapi Pemain Yang Lebih Tinggi… Ingin membawa game Clash Royale Anda ke level berikutnya? Berjuang untuk mengalahkan pemain level yang lebih tinggi? Berikut adalah beberapa tips dan trik untuk membantu Anda! 1. Tingkatkan Kartu Anda:…
- Bagaimana Cara Melaporkan Masalah Dengan Akun Paypal Anda? Penting untuk melaporkan masalah dengan akun PayPal Anda sesegera mungkin, terutama jika Anda mencurigai bahwa akun Anda telah disusupi atau Anda mengalami kesulitan melakukan pembayaran. Bergantung pada masalah Anda, Anda…
- Cara Menggunakan Aplikasi Netflix Di PC Tertentu Apakah Anda ingin tahu cara menggunakan aplikasi Netflix di PC khusus Anda? Ini lebih mudah dari yang kau kira. Dengan beberapa langkah sederhana, Anda bisa mendapatkan akses ke perpustakaan besar…
- Tutorial Cara Menggunakan Aplikasi Netflix Apakah Anda siap untuk menjelajahi dunia streaming video dengan Netflix? Baik Anda pengguna baru atau berpengalaman, mempelajari cara menggunakan aplikasi Netflix sangat penting untuk membuka potensi penuh layanan. Pertama, Anda…
- Tutorial Cara Menggunakan Aplikasi Spotify Untuk Pemula Apakah Anda seorang pemula dalam dunia streaming musik? Apakah Anda bertanya - tanya bagaimana Anda dapat memanfaatkan platform streaming musik Spotify yang kuat? Di blog ini, kami akan memberi Anda…
- Bagaimana Cara Membatalkan Transaksi Paypal? Apakah Anda ingin membatalkan transaksi PayPal? Ini tidak sesulit yang Anda pikirkan. Meskipun Anda tidak selalu dapat membatalkan transaksi PayPal, ada beberapa hal yang dapat Anda coba untuk menghentikan pembayaran.…
- Cara Menggunakan Aplikasi Netflix Di Smartphone… Apakah Anda pengguna Netflix? Jika demikian, kemungkinan Anda sudah tahu cara menggunakan aplikasi Netflix di ponsel cerdas Anda. Tetapi tahukah Anda bahwa Anda dapat memanfaatkan spesifikasi spesifik dalam aplikasi untuk…
- Setting Laragon Agar Bisa Di Akses Via Lan Nginx Setting Laragon Agar Bisa di Akses via LAN Nginx Mengenal Laragon Laragon adalah perangkat lunak open-source Windows yang dirancang untuk membuat web development secepat mungkin. Ini berarti Anda dapat membuat…
- Membuat Nginx Proxy Ubuntu Lebih Dari Satu Subdomain Membuat Nginx Proxy Ubuntu Lebih Dari Satu Subdomain Apa Nginx Proxy? Nginx Proxy adalah sebuah web server dan layanan proxy. Berbeda dari web server lain seperti Apache dan Microsoft IIS,…